In February, Taylor generally has pleasant temperatures and moderate rainfall. February is a winter month. Daytime temperatures hover around 18°C, while nights can cool down to about 4°C.
Taylor in February usually receives moderate rainfall, averaging around 39 mm for the month. It is the driest month of the year. For those who prefer outdoor activities, it's a great time to explore without the huge concern of sudden downpours. Delving into the climate records from the past 30 years, one can predict that nearly 6 days of the month will see rainfall.
The city usually sees around 169 hours of sunlight, indicating a moderately sunny period.
If your ideal day consists of dry skies and moderate temperatures March, April and November generally stand out with the best circumstances. While August tends to showcase less optimal conditions.
